Summary
Enables protein homodimerization activity. Predicted to be involved in acetyl-CoA metabolic process and farnesyl diphosphate biosynthetic process, mevalonate pathway. Predicted to be located in cytoplasm. Predicted to be active in cytosol. [provided by Alliance of Genome Resources, Apr 2022]
